A Deadly Stowaway

The story begins with a cluster of severe respiratory illnesses on the MV Hondius cruise ship in May 2026. The culprit? The Andes Virus, a rare hantavirus capable of limited person-to-person transmission. This outbreak resulted in multiple deaths, raising alarms about the potential for rodents to introduce dangerous zoonotic pathogens into the confined space of a cruise ship.

What makes this particularly fascinating is the historical connection. Rodents have been unwelcome shipmates for centuries, most notably during the Black Death in the 1300s. Despite modern sanitation systems, these pests still find their way onto ships, creating an ecological niche for viruses like hantavirus.

Clinical Complexity

Hantavirus infections present a dual threat in the form of Hantavirus Pulmonary Syndrome (HPS) and Haemorrhagic Fever with Renal Syndrome (HFRS). These syndromes are severe and potentially fatal, with HPS dominating in the Americas and HFRS in Europe and Asia. The clinical picture is complex, with symptoms ranging from influenza-like illness to abdominal pain and vomiting.

Diagnosis is a challenge, requiring a high index of suspicion and a careful medical history. Blood tests reveal a host of abnormalities, and chest X-rays often show bilateral interstitial infiltrates. The key to diagnosis lies in considering rodent exposure, travel history, and environmental factors.

A Vascular Battle

Hantaviruses target endothelial cells lining blood vessels, leading to immune-mediated vascular dysfunction. In HPS, the pulmonary microvasculature is under attack, causing rapid fluid accumulation in the lungs. Patients can deteriorate rapidly, progressing to respiratory failure within hours. HFRS, on the other hand, primarily affects the kidneys, leading to vascular leakage and inflammation.

Treatment and Prevention

The lack of a specific treatment for hantavirus infection underscores the importance of early medical intervention. Oxygen therapy, haemodynamic support, and mechanical ventilation are often necessary. While vaccines are in development, including mRNA vaccines, currently, only whole virus inactivated vaccines are licensed for human use in China and the Republic of Korea, but their efficacy is uncertain.

Prevention focuses on rodent control and education. Cruise ships must implement rigorous sanitation practices, rapid remediation of infestations, and strict waste management. Passengers, especially those visiting endemic regions, need to be aware of the risks and take precautions.
